I'm very concerned about a rule change before the Securities and Exchange Commission that will empower companies to control our nation's natural resources and public land access. 


If the SEC allows NAC's (Natural Asset Companies) to find investors and capital through the stock exchange, these companies will have the financial ability to obtain conservation leases and other ecological performance rights to prevent any uses they deem unsuitable on public lands. 


This in essence takes control of our public lands out of the public domain and puts it in the hands of a small powerful minority. This is absolutely unacceptable!
